PREDICTION OF LIQUID-VAPOR EQUILIBRIA FROM AN EMPIRICAL EQUATION OF STATE FOR MIXTURES

Abstract

A method is presented of calculating the equilibrium phase boundary which requires only an equation of state for mixtures and the set of constants for each of the pure components. The binary system of n-heptane and nitrogen is investigated. The results which are graphed for 298.13 deg, 373.13 deg, 448.13 deg, and 498.13 deg K appeared to be in agreement with the experimental results of Palmer, Hirschfelder, and Boyd. (NRL, CM-702) but not with those of Boomer, Johnson, and Piercy (Can. J. Research 16:396, 1938).
